Surprised not to see Mbappé in the France squad, says Donnarumma
Photo : Bdnews24

If Kylian Mbappé were in the squad, he could surely cause trouble for Italy,” says the goalkeeper.

The forward who should have been the biggest concern for Italy’s goalkeeper is missing from the squad! Gianluigi Donnarumma expressed his surprise at not seeing Kylian Mbappé’s name in France’s squad. However, this doesn’t mean Italy’s goalkeeper is taking it easy. He also highlighted the strength of France’s alternative forwards.

France coach Didier Deschamps has not included Mbappé in the squad for the two matches in this round of the Nations League. In the previous round, Mbappé missed games due to a thigh injury. This time, the coach has not clarified the reasons behind leaving him out.

Playing without Mbappé, France drew their last match against Israel. On Sunday, they face Italy.

France and Italy have already secured their places in the quarter-finals from Group A2. This match will decide the group winner.

On the eve of the clash, Donnarumma admitted that Mbappé could have been a major headache for Italy.

“I don’t know what’s happening with their squad selections or what happened with Mbappé, but this is definitely a significant absence. I know Kylian very well. He’s one of the best in the world, and if he were playing, he could have put us in serious trouble.”

Donnarumma, however, is well aware of France’s squad depth. Playing for PSG at the club level, he is familiar with many of the French players and knows they have plenty of attacking options. He specifically mentioned three of his club teammates.

“They have many excellent players. I know them well, and they are all of high quality. They have outstanding forwards like Barcola, Kolo Muani, and Zaire-Emery, who play alongside me at the club. Barcola is an unbelievable talent. So, they have such alternatives that can cause us problems.”

Italy remains unbeaten at the top of the group with 13 points from five matches. France is second with 10 points.
